Find out more and decide if Anguilla is the right place for Your luxury vacation: Anguilla LocationAnguilla - British West Indies (BWI). This island is an English independent territory located in the "Leewards" portion of the NE Caribbean Sea, about 6 miles north of Saint Martin and less than 200 miles east of Puerto Rico. Getting To AnguillaThe primary air carrier into Anguilla´s Wallblake Airport is American Eagle (from San Juan), which coordinates with American Airline flights into and out of the United States and Canada. Also, many carriers provide jet service into nearby Saint Martin. The short trip from St. Martin to Anguilla is made by small charter flight or a ferry ride (a wonderful way to see Anguilla for the first time). Anguilla Climate & WeatherAnguilla LanguageEnglish is the official and spoken language on Anguilla. Anguilla Currency$US currency is accepted everywhere on Anguilla, and most establishments accept all major credit cards. Anguilla FoodAnguilla is renowned for its' 5-Star 'haute cuisine' restaurants, that are famously visited by media celebrities and business magnates. The food is guaranteed to please anyone taking a luxury vacation. High-end places to eat include (in alphabetical order) Blanchards, Hibernia, Mango's, Olivers, Overlook, Straw Hat, and Tasty's. Anguilla AccommodationAnguilla hosts many fine hotels, resorts, inns and B&B's. Inside Advice - Due to taxes and other legislation/regulation on Anguilla, hotels and other accommodations tend to be relatively expensive. However, many luxury villas are owned by off-islanders who only use them occasionally, and offer them for rent the rest of the time. As a result you can usually rent an entire luxury villa for a fraction of the cost of a hotel suite!
Things To Do On Anguilla - Recreation & EntertainmentTake Your luxury vacation on Anguilla and experience "Tranquility Wrapped In Blue":Anguillas' Beaches & WatersAnguilla is a long and thin island, creating an endless tropical shoreline with 33 of the world´s most beautiful beaches. Many are over 1˝ miles long - and not one has a high-rise building. All of Anguillas' beaches are public and entirely uncrowded. Some are entirely unoccupied, others have beach bars, visually pleasing hotels, and spectacular villas. Charter a sail boat or powerboat and visit one of Anguillas' many offshore cays or secluded coves. Charter a fishing boat and angle for large gamefish such as Marlin, Swordfish, Tuna, Wahoo, & Yellowfin. Anguilla ElectricityMains electricity on Anguilla is provided at 110V alternating at 60Hz. Anguilla SizeAnguilla is about 16 miles long and 3 miles across at its' widest point, covering about 35 square miles in area.
